A Commitment to Reality

Christian Research Institute

Hosted by Dave Hanegraaff A Commitment to Reality is a podcast for a post-truth—and increasingly post-reality—age. We are living through one of the most disorienting periods in human history—leaving many to wonder: What is reality? As artificial intelligence accelerates and institutional trust erodes, our shared sense of what is real continues to crumble. Reality is the way the world truly is—independent of our beliefs, opinions, or illusions. If truth is the map by which we navigate our lives, then it is no surprise that we feel disoriented when we live by lies. The post-truth, post-reality crisis is not merely an intellectual problem; it is an existential one. A commitment to reality is a dedication to discerning what is true and developing the discipline to live in alignment with that truth—with reality. This podcast is an apologetic for reality—each episode serving as an intentional act of grounding our existence together as we commit to what is beautiful, good, and true.

    When Ideas Meet Reality — Economics, AI, and Fasting with Jay Richards

    Jay Richards and Dave Hanegraaff explore why reality requires commitment, embodiment, and disciplined practices that keep us grounded when our digital lives lead us into abstraction.   This is a wide-ranging conversation, beginning with the reality of economics before diving deep into the accelerating presence and authority of AI and why the tech debate is ultimately about anthropology—what a human person is, and what we’re becoming. Jay makes the case for why the forgotten discipline of fasting is a forgotten fountain of fortitude—for body, mind and soul—especially in a culture of excess increasingly out of touch with reality Thank you for joining A Commitment to Reality, hosted by Dave Hanegraaff.     Making a Commitment to Reality — with Frederica Mathewes-Green

    Welcome to A Commitment to Reality, hosted by Dave Hanegraaff.Frederica Mathewes-Green and Dave Hanegraaff explore the importance of  “shared reality” in a post-truth age—and why the most important word in the title might be commitment.This is a wide-ranging conversation about what it means to live in alignment with reality, while also hitting topics such as how the internet is optimized for outrage, why our social muscles are atrophying, and why AI feels different from every other tool: it presents itself like a person—earning trust and authority fast.
